Blue Roofing and Gutters is Hiring a Project Manager Near Akron, OH

Job Title: Project Manager (Roofing)

Job Description:

Blue Roofing is seeking a skilled and experienced Project Manager to oversee our roofing projects from initiation to completion. As a Project Manager, you will be responsible for coordinating and managing all aspects of roofing projects to ensure they are completed safely, efficiently, and to the highest quality standards.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Project Planning and Scheduling: Develop comprehensive project plans, including timelines, resource allocation, and budgets, in coordination with the sales team and clients. Ensure that project schedules are met and deadlines are achieved.
  • Client Communication: Serve as the primary point of contact for clients throughout the duration of roofing projects. Keep clients informed about project progress, address any concerns or questions they may have, and ensure their satisfaction with the completed work.
  • Team Leadership: Lead and motivate the roofing project team, including subcontractors and crew members, to ensure that they work cohesively towards project goals. Provide guidance, support, and direction to team members as needed.
  • Quality Control: Implement and maintain quality control measures to ensure that roofing projects meet industry standards and exceed client expectations. Conduct regular inspections to identify and address any issues or defects promptly.
  • Safety Compliance: Prioritize safety on all roofing projects by enforcing safety protocols and ensuring that all team members adhere to safety guidelines and regulations. Conduct regular safety meetings and inspections to promote a culture of safety awareness.
  • Budget Management: Monitor project budgets and expenditures closely to ensure that projects are completed within budgetary constraints. Identify cost-saving opportunities and efficiencies without compromising quality or safety.
  • Documentation and Reporting: Maintain accurate project documentation, including contracts, permits, change orders, and progress reports. Provide regular updates to stakeholders on project status, milestones, and any deviations from the original plan.
  • Continuous Improvement: Identify areas for process improvement and implement best practices to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of roofing project management operations. Foster a culture of continuous learning and innovation within the project team.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ree in construction management, engineering, or a related field (preferred).
  • Proven experience in project management, specifically in the roofing or construction industry.
  • Strong leadership and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ively communicate and collaborate with diverse stakeholders.
  • Excellent organizational and time management abilities, with a keen att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in project management software and tools.
  • Knowledge of roofing materials, techniques, and regulations is a plus.
  • OSHA certification or willingness to obtain certification.
  • Valid driver's license and reliable transportation.
